Our Company

Miso Robotics is transforming the food industry, and making lives better. We've developed an AI-powered kitchen robot named Flippy which automates the most repetitive of kitchen tasks, such as operating a deep fryer. Flippy is fun to watch, but under the hood, he’s powered by a sophisticated AI platform – all driven by  our proprietary deep learning experience and patented technologies.

Miso is a well known first-mover in kitchen automation, AI, and robotics.  The company has raised over $100 million from crowdfunding, which we believe makes it THE most successful crowdfunding story in history.  It has successfully piloted its products with the most prominent global brands in food, and now it’s time for the company to partner with  institutional capital and super-charge the commercialization of what we do.

The Role

As a Senior Electrical Engineer, you will work closely with integrated product teams as a key technical leader of the electrical system and design across all of Miso’s products . What You’ll Do

  • Work closely with electrical,  mechanical, software, and test engineers to deliver fully functional products
  • Work with the Product and R&D teams to define the requirements of the electrical and electronic components for our products. 
  • Supporting product development through all phases of development
  • Execute hands-on work to create the electrical and electronic components of our robotic system, assemble the robotic hardware system
  • Debug and test the overall system to ensure reliability.
  • Create schematics, PCB designs, Master Wiring Diagram, build materials, test procedures and reports. 
  • Integrate and test new features and functions on our robotic systems. 
  • Create cable harness designs and assembly instructions for high-reliability applications.
  • Proactively identify roadblocks to technical progress and take steps to mitigate.
  • Serve as a technical leader within the organization and help to define and standardize processes.
